Connect to your website through WebDav

STEP ONE:

Go to MY NETWORK PLACES icon. This will either be an icon on your desktop or located on your start menu.

STEP TWO:

Choose ADD NETWORK PLACE. This step will open a Wizard. Once the Wizard is open, take the following steps:

  1. Click NEXT
  2. Choose the option to “Choose another network location. Specify the address of a Web site, network location, or FTP site.”
  3. Enter the full URL for the website you wish to connect to, adding a/webdav at the end of the URL (for example http://vcho.cisat.jmu.edu/webdav)
  4. You will be asked to enter a username and password. You will need to use your full login name and your CISATNT password. (for example, your login name would be cisatnt\yourusernamehere) Make sure you use the appropriate “\” in this place. If you cannot remember your username or password, email HELP@cisat.jmu.eduOnce you have successfully entered your login name and password, you will get notifca tion of success on the next Wizard screen. A checkbox to “Open this network place when I click Finish” should be checked. Click FINISH and the directory for your site will appear.
  5. To connect to your site in the future, just go back to MY NETWORK PLACES and your site will show up on a list of connected sites. You only have to add the site once. You will be asked to enter your login name and password each time you reconnect.
  6. Once you are connected, you can simply DRAG and DROP files onto your site. The easiest way to do this is you keep a window open with your site directory. While the site directory window is open, open a second window that displays the local files that make up your website. Drag files from your local window on the site window. When you do this, your website will be updated.
